Output 52f3cfc781064193f9257af7a1756d23dc7e46fba9de8c43970f0b6a2f96e57f:0

value
516389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c05f5f55d987190b12c8e39f81bd0fb28c8ed2d OP_EQUAL
address
38czRHUHX8TREj5Xxn6S72MoENHX9ZBZC5
transaction
52f3cfc781064193f9257af7a1756d23dc7e46fba9de8c43970f0b6a2f96e57f
spent
true